During the public comment period on March 28, citizen P.K. Pettus addressed the Planning Commission urging protection of the Roanoke Creek corridor.
Pettus cited Virginia’s Natural Heritage Data Explorer mapping and suggested private conservation easements as tools to preserve the corridor. She also said she had participated in State Corporation Commission (SCC) hearings on Dominion’s solar projects, including Courthouse Solar, and mentioned access to related records.
The minutes do not record a response from the commission or any immediate action directed to staff; the comment is entered into the public record.
